Region: The North York Moors National Park covers 554 square miles, with landscape ranging from heather-clad moorland and deep secluded dales, to the cliffs and coves of the magnificent coastline making it a haven for walkers.
Town: The pretty village of Snainton is ideally situated between Pickering and Scarborough and at the foot of North York Moors National Park. Snainton has many amenities including a shop/post office and two pubs that serve food. For those that like horses, there is an excellent riding centre that provides for all ages and abilities. Nearby there is a superb driving range with a 9 hole golf course, cycle rides and quad biking. A short drive away is Dalby Forest, with fantastic opportunities for walking, mountain biking and the opportunity to experience the Go Ape adventure park. Also easily accessible by car are the seaside resorts of Scarborough and Whitby, the market town of Pickering and the historic city of York.
